df -h 什么意思
时间: 2025-01-19 11:03:21 浏览: 48
### df -h 命令的作用
`df -h` 是 Linux 中用于查看磁盘空间使用情况的命令。此命令提供了一个简洁的人类可读格式来展示文件系统的总体磁盘利用率,包括各个分区的空间总量、已使用的量以及可用空间等信息[^2]。
具体来说:
- **Filesystem** 列展示了各文件系统所在的分区及其对应的设备名称;
- **Size** 表明了整个文件系统的总容量大小;
- **Used** 显示已经占用了多少存储空间;
- **Avail (Available)** 提供还有多少未被利用的空间可供分配给新数据写入操作;
- **Use%** 给出了当前已被消耗掉的比例百分比形式呈现出来;
- **Mounted on** 描述了这些卷是在哪里安装到主机上的路径位置。
对于希望快速获取关于服务器上所有挂载点状态概览的人来说非常有用。
### 使用实例
下面是一个简单的 `df -h` 输出例子说明如何解释其结果:
```bash
$ df -h
Filesystem Size Used Avail Use% Mounted on
udev 7.8G 0 7.8G 0% /dev
tmpfs 1.6G 2.3M 1.6G 1% /run
/dev/sda1 99G 45G 50G 46% /
tmpfs 7.8G 180K 7.8G 1% /dev/shm
```
这里可以看到 `/dev/sda1` 这个硬盘分区总共拥有大约 99GB 的空间,其中约有 45 GB 已经被占用了,剩下大概 50 GB 可用作进一步的数据保存用途,并且它已经被挂在根目录 (`/`) 下面作为主要的工作区之一。
值得注意的是,`df -h` 默认只报告那些已经被成功加载过的文件系统详情。若需获得更全面的结果,则应考虑采用带有 `-a` 参数的形式执行相同功能但覆盖范围更大的查询方式[^1]。
阅读全文
相关推荐


















